SIGNING OF RENEGOTIATED PHIL-ROK SOCIAL SECURITY AGREEMENT


The Embassy wishes to share with the public the Press Release of the Social Security System (SSS) regarding the signing of the renegotiated Philippines ? Republic of Korea Social Security Agreement (SSA) on the sidelines of the ROK-ASEAN Commemorative Summit in Busan on 25 November 2019.

President Rodrigo Roa Duterte and Republic of Korea President Moon Jae-in witnessed the signing by Foreign Affairs Secretary Teodoro Locsin, Jr. and Korean Foreign Minister Kang Kyung-wha of the renegotiated SSA, which addressed the concerns of the Overseas Filipino Workers (OFWs) in Korea wherein the social security coverage will remain under Korea's National Pension Service (NPS) and there will be no transfer of contribution from the NPS to the SSS.

The renegotiated agreement also provides an option for OFWs to refund their NPS contribution at the end of the sojourn in Korea, under the same conditions given to Korean nationals.

To get maximum benefits from social security, SSS also encourages OFWs who will opt for lump-sum refund to continue being active SSS members on voluntary basis to ensure their eligibility for SSS pension benefits in the future.

Members of the Filipino community in Korea are encouraged to participate in an SSS Forum to be held in cooperation with the Embassy to get to know more about the SSA and the programs and services for OFWs under the new SS Law. The Embassy will issue an Advisory once the schedule of the SSS Forum has been determined. END
